Borax Crystal Snowflakes

Glass jar
pipe cleaners
Borax
yarn or string
water

Instructions:
1. Boil about 2 cups of water
2. Shape pipe cleaners into snowflake shapes
3. Tie a string to each snowflake, and loop around pencil
4. Dump 1/2 cup of borax into jar
5. Pour boiling water in, and stir to dissolve borax
6. Put snowflakes in, hanging from the pencil, making sure they are submerged
7. Wait one day and you will have beautiful sparkly snowflakes!
